PASTORAL CARE

The uniqueness of individuals is highly valued at Formby High School and we make great efforts to place the nurturing of our students’ talents is at the heart of all that we do.

We place particular importance on pastoral care and personal development, and provide every Year Seven student with the security of being placed in a smaller than average tutor group when they first join us. We make sure students then retain the same form teacher and Climate for Learning Leader throughout their time with us.

The benefits of doing this are significant in terms of consistency of care, support and guidance.

Further care is provided by our Climate for Learning Leaders who are assigned to year groups and by our committed team of pastoral staff who are based in the on-site Student Support Centre.

All teachers and staff at Formby High School do not accept second best in terms of standards of behaviour and our students are expected to work hard, respect themselves and others.

At the end of their time with us our students leave Formby High School as young adults equipped with the skills, qualifications, determination and confidence to succeed in life.
